This course has 1800+ Interactive Practice Exam Questions with Rationale. It examines the unique principles of nursing care for infants, children, and adolescents. Emphasis is placed on growth and development, family-centered care, health promotion, and the pathophysiology and management of common acute and chronic childhood illnesses. Clinical rotations take place in pediatric inpatient units, outpatient clinics, and community settings.
